KONQER Apocalypse rescheduled to May 25

Saipan’s KONQER Apocalypse Obstacle Course Challenge has been rescheduled from April 27 to May 25, according to KONQER president Kelli Wedd and MVA managing director Chris Concepcion. “With so many community events taking place in April and May, and with some logistical issues we...

Access road between Fiesta, Hyatt impassable

The public is being advised that the access road between the Fiesta Resort & Spa Saipan and Hyatt Regency Saipan in Garapan will undergo paving this week and will not be accessible. In a notice last Friday, it said that the paving project will last three days, from April 15...

OPA staff will be on Rota, Tinian

The staff of the Office of the Public Auditor will be in Rota on April 16, 2019, Tuesday, and on Tinian on April 17, 2019, Wednesday, to notarize and accept filings of financial disclosure statements from government officials. The notice last Friday covers all appointed/elected...
